The origin of Arroz de leite is due to the expansion of rice cultivation in Brazil after the colonization by the Portuguese.
Several recipes were created using this grain, mainly as a dessert that is easily accessible and affordable.
In the northeast, for example, coconut milk is usually used to make the preparation sweeter for the traditional festa junina, a typical regional celebration where the main culinary preparations are based on a grain, corn or rice, with coconut milk, cow’s milk, or condensed milk.
This is how the popular expression “arroz-de-festa” was born.
In the southeast region, rice milk is prepared according to the traditional recipe that contains only rice and milk in its composition.
Without sweetening, this is a “savory” version, different from the sweet one with condensed milk and cinnamon, as in the Mexican version already on the blog:

Ingredients
- 3/4 cup rice (basmati type)
- 1 1/4 cups water
- 2/3 cup milk
- 1 tablespoon butter
- to taste salt
Steps
In a casserole, mix the rice, salt, and water.
Bring to a boil and cook for about 12 minutes.
When the rice is ready, add the butter and milk, incorporating them into the mixture.
Cook for another 5 minutes, stirring continuously, until the rice reaches a creamy consistency.
Serve the rice hot.

FAQ (Frequently Asked Questions)
How did sweet rice spread in Portugal?
Historians claim that the origin of sweet rice, cooked in milk, in Portugal, dates back to the Arab people. These populations conquered the Iberian Peninsula region during the Middle Ages and spread their food culture throughout Europe.
Through medieval cuisine, where there was an abundance of peasants and consequently an extensive cultivation of grains, like rice, as well as cattle farming, from which milk and its derivatives were produced, these two types of food came together and gave birth to rice and milk.
From then on, the recipe became known in Europe, arriving in Brazil through Portuguese colonization.
